A 103 pJ/bit multi-channel reconfigurable GMSK/PSK/16-QAM transmitter with band-shaping

摘要

A 401~406MHz GMSK/PSK/16-QAM TX with band-shaping is realized in 65nm CMOS occupying area of 0.4mm. Coupled DLL based phase interpolated synthesizer with injection-locked ring oscillator, we achieve frequency tuning and multi-phase output without any need of phase calibration. Through direct quadrature modulation at digital PA, the TX achieves less than 6% EVM for data rate up to 12.5Mb/s. The band-shaping maximizes spectral efficiency with ACPR of -33dB. Consuming 2.57mW, the TX achieves energy efficiency of 103pJ/bit.
